The Health Care System Division(HCSD) provides analytical and policy leadership on issues related to broader health system renewal such as fiscal transfers, governance and accountability, innovation and productivity in health care, and the roles and interface of the public and private sectors. It also coordinates and provides policy leadership in the Health Care Policy Directorate on horizontal issues such as monitoring the implementation of First Ministers’ agreements, performance reporting and research. As well, the Division provides secretariat support to the federal/provincial/territorial Advisory Committee on Governance and Accountability. Finally, the Division develops strategic plans for Health Canada in health care, and coordinates departmental work on the health care issues. 1, record 1, English, - Health%20Care%20System%20Division

Electronic tacheometers or total stations are instruments which combine electronic theodolite and EDM [electronic distance measurement] instruments. They can display horizontal angle, vertical angle, slope distance, horizontal distance, difference in elevation, and coordinates. 1, record 4, English, - total%20station

Un tachéomètre électronique est l’équivalent d’un théodolite où les mesures sont effectuées électroniquement, affichées sur un écran à cristaux liquides et sauvegardées dans une mémoire interne. Le tachéomètre mesure l’angle horizontal de la lunette sur le plateau par rapport à une ligne de référence et l’angle vertical de la lunette par rapport au plan horizontal. Il mesure aussi, et c’est sa principale qualité, la distance entre un prisme de réflexion et l’axe verticale de la lunette au moyen d’un rayon laser en mesurant le temps de parcours du rayon. En utilisant la trigonométrie, le tachéomètre peut convertir ces données en coordonnées cartésiennes (X, Y, Z) ou en coordonnées cylindriques (angle, distance, élévation). 4, record 4, French, - tach%C3%A9om%C3%A8tre%20%C3%A9lectronique
Record number: 4, Textual support number: 2 CONT
[...] comme le théodolite qui l’a précédé, le tachéomètre permet de mesurer les angles horizontaux (ou azimutaux) et verticaux. La détermination planimétrique d’un point s’effectue par rayonnement, et par nivellement indirect pour les mesures indirectes. Mais à la différence du premier, il est aussi capable d’évaluer les distances. Les modèles qui peuvent en outre enregistrer en temps réel les grandeurs mesurées (cas de la plupart des appareils aujourd’hui) sont appelés « station totale ». Enfin, certains appareils intègrent même désormais un récepteur GPS, qui détermine lui-même sa position et occasionne donc un gain d’efficacité supplémentaire. 5, record 4, French, - tach%C3%A9om%C3%A8tre%20%C3%A9lectronique

Named in honor of René Descartes("I think therefore I am"), Cartesian coordinates use an arbitrary grid with an origin(0, 0) in the lower left, and increasing X and Y axes. The X axis runs horizontally, the Y axis vertically, and the locations within the plane are described using(X, Y) pairs. The X value describes the horizontal location of the point, and the Y value describes the vertical location. Cartesian coordinates are sometimes called plane coordinates because they describe point locations in a plan. See also Projection. 2, record 7, English, - cartesian%20coordinates

A description of the purely geometrical contribution to the uncertainty in a position fix, given by the expression DOP = SQRT(TRACE(AA)) where AA is the design matrix for the instantaneous position solution (dependent on satellite-receiver geometry). 2, record 9, English, - dilution%20of%20precision
Record number: 9, Textual support number: 1 OBS
The DOP factor depends on the parameters of the position-fix solution. Standard terms for the GPS application are : GDOP Geometric(three position coordinates plus clock offset in the solution). PDOP Position(three coordinates). HDOP Horizontal(two horizontal coordinates). VDOP Vertical(height only). TDOP Time(clock offset only). RDOP Relative(normalized to 60 seconds). 2, record 9, English, - dilution%20of%20precision

[A] laser scanner captures reality by digitizing an object with a laser. Every transmitted laser pulse is used to measure a distance to the point of reflection, and simultaneously, horizontal and vertical angle measurements are taken. These basic measurements are being used to calculate three-dimensional coordinates for individual points. A laser scanner is typically able to measure between 1, 000 to 2, 000 points per second, with sub-centimeter accuracy. 3, record 10, English, - laser%20scanner

An orthogonal system of curvilinear coordinates used to describe fluid motion and consisting of an axis t tangent to the instantaneous velocity vector and an axis n normal to this velocity vector to the left in the horizontal plane, to which a vertically directed axis z may be added for description of three-dimensional flow. 1, record 13, English, - natural%20coordinates

Coordinate system in which the x and y coordinates denote projections on the horizontal plane towards east and north, respectively, the projection along the vertical axis being denoted by the pressure p. 4, record 15, English, - pressure%20coordinate%20system
Record number: 15, Textual support number: 1 CONT
The pressure coordinate system is used for investigation of both the large and meso scales of thermospheric circulation. 5, record 15, English, - pressure%20coordinate%20system
